Executive Summary:
This document presents the Minister of Tourism's response to questions regarding funds allocated, sanctioned, disbursed, and utilized in Rohtas and Kaimur districts of Bihar under the Swadesh Darshan Scheme (SDS) since its inception. It details financial assistance provided through various central sector schemes and initiatives. The response clarifies the role of State Governments/UT Administrations in tourism development and outlines specific projects sanctioned in Bihar under Swadesh Darshan, SD2.0, and CBDD schemes.

* **Project Details (Bihar):**
* Specific projects sanctioned under Swadesh Darshan, SD2.0, and CBDD in Bihar, including circuit names, project names, sanctioned amounts, and authorized/utilized amounts, are detailed in the annexure.
* **Swadesh Darshan Scheme:**
* Tirthankar Circuit (Vaishali Arrah Masad Patna Rajgir Pawapuri Champapuri): ₹33.96 Crore Sanctioned, ₹30.04 Crore Released, ₹29.36 Crore Utilized.
* Spiritual Circuit (Kanwaria Route: Sultanganj Dharmshala Deoghar): ₹44.76 Crore Sanctioned, ₹42.52 Crore Released, ₹42.17 Crore Utilized.
* Buddhist Circuit (Construction of Convention Centre at Bodhgaya): ₹95.18 Crore Sanctioned, Released and Utilized.
* Rural Circuit (Development of Bhitiharwa Chandrahia Turkaulia): ₹44.27 Crore Sanctioned, ₹40.31 Crore Released and Utilized.
* Spiritual Circuit (Development of Mandar Hill Ang Pradesh): ₹44.55 Crore Sanctioned, ₹42.32 Crore Released and Utilized.
* **Swadesh Darshan 2.0 Scheme:**
* Development of the Buddhist Meditation Experience Centre, Bodh Gaya: ₹165.44 Crore Sanctioned, ₹16.54 Crore Authorized for utilization.
* **Challenge Based Destination Development (CBDD) Scheme:**
* Development of Tourist Facilities at Sonepur Mela Ground, Saran: ₹24.29 Crore Sanctioned, ₹2.43 Crore Authorized for utilization.

GOVERNMENT OF INDIA
MINISTRY OF TOURISM
LOK SABHA
UNSTARRED QUESTION NO. †1347
ANSWERED ON 28.07.2025
FUNDS UNDER SDS IN ROHTAS AND KAIMUR, BIHAR
†1347. SHRI MANOJ KUMAR:
Will the Minister of TOURISM be pleased to state:
(a) the details of the funds allocated, sanctioned, disbursed and utilised
in Rohtas and Kaimur districts of Bihar under Swadesh Darshan
Scheme (SDS) since its inception, year-wise;
(b) the details of the technological integration being carried out under
the said scheme for improvement in tourist services and visitor
engagement particularly in the said districts;
(c) whether the Government proposes to find out the possibilities of
partnership with international agencies to enhance basic level
amenities by developing the sites in the said districts under the said
scheme;
(d) if so, the details thereof; and
(e) whether the Government has prepared a comprehensive roadmap to
cover the said sites in the said districts for expansion of the said
scheme including the names of the said sites and if so, the details
thereof?
ANSWER
THE MINISTER OF TOURISM (SHRI GAJENDRA SINGH SHEKHAWAT)
(a) to (e): Development and Promotion of tourist destinations and tourism
products is primarily undertaken by the respective State Government/
Union Territory (UT) Administration. However, the Ministry of Tourism
through its central sector schemes of ‘Swadesh Darshan(SD)’, Swadesh
Darshan 2.0 (SD2.0)’, ‘Challenge Based Destination Development (CBDD)’ –
a sub-scheme of Swadesh Darshan and ‘Pilgrimage Rejuvenation and
Spiritual, Heritage Augmentation Drive (PRASHAD)’ complements the
efforts of tourism infrastructure development by extending financial
assistance to the State Governments/UT Administrations; subject toavailability of funds, adherence to scheme guidelines, submission of
Detailed Project Reports (DPRs) by the State Government etc.
In addition, Government of India under its initiative for ‘Special
Assistance to States for Capital Investment (SASCI)’ has also provided
financial assistance to the States for development of tourism projects.
The details of the projects sanctioned along-with funds allocated,
released/authorized and utilized under Swadesh Darshan, SD2.0 and CBDD
scheme in the state of Bihar is Annexed.
In the project proposal received from States/UTs, certain
components such as digital displays under the interpretation centre,
website development for online ticketing and Augmented Reality/ Virtual
Reality (AR/VR) facilities under the tourist information centre are included
by the concerned State Governments/UT Administrations.
Currently, no tourism programs under Ministry of Tourism are being
funded by international agencies.
